44 > 20110216:
45 >        Introduce igb(4) and split Intel Gigabit Ethernet adapters between
46 >        igb(4) and em(4).  Newer devices use igb(4).  The code has moved
47 >        to sys/dev/e1000 for both devices in the kernel. igb(4) has
48 >        been placed in GENERIC on i386 and amd64.

95 > 20101120:
96 >        Several portions of the kernel and userland code related to UFS file
97 >        systems (and UFS2) cannot properly handle inode counts above 2^31 due
98 >        to use of int types.  Based on a patch from FreeBSD, I've modified
99 >        our UFS2 implementation to handle unsigned values for inode counts
100 >        which should allow for file systems greater than 16TB.
101 >
102 >        newfs and growfs was also modified.

129 > 20100814:
130 >        libdispatch added to MidnightBSD.  This provides functionality found in
131 >        Mac OS X's GCD.  We do not have blocks support yet.  As this code is
132 >        licensed under Apache 2, we create a new MK_APACHE option so that
133 >        it's not required for all users to run code under a license they
134 >        may not like.

257 > 20090606:
258 >        Remove PCC from the base system.  This compiler will not work
259 >        as a system compiler for us as we've got some userland investment
260 >        in C++ code and may have Objective-C in the future.  We're stuck
261 >        with a solution that supports these three languages at a minimum.
262 >
263 >        I had wanted to keep it as an optional compiler because it is
264 >        fast, however too many users want to try to use it for the base
265 >        system which makes no sense.

301 > 20090405:
302 >        xorg 7.4 wants to configure its input devices via hald which does not
303 >        yet work with USB. If the keyboard/mouse does not work in xorg then
304 >        add
305 >                Option "AllowEmptyInput" "off"
306 >        to your ServerLayout section.  This will cause X to use the configured
307 >        kbd and mouse sections from your xorg.conf
